Bug#381979: debian-installer: selected keymap is not used by graphical-installer
Package: debian-installer
Severity: normal
i selected the dvorak keymap when using the graphical-installer,
however, the gui still used the standard qwerty keymap. once booted
into the base system, the dvorak keymap was indeed used. so just the
graphical-installer seems to ignore the keymap, but it was indeed set up
correctly.
